阻止应用程序打开浏览器


8

有没有免费的应用程序可以拦截来自应用程序的打开URL的请求,并提示我是否要打开URL?(例如,安装Adobe Reader之后,它将打开其网站以获取有关安装过程的反馈。)

理想情况下,它将是仅用于此任务的轻量级软件,但是如果较大的防火墙/安全应用程序提供此功能,则可以接受。

我正在使用Windows 7 32位。

如下面的评论中所述,其想法是您不希望浏览器打开(假设它尚未运行),因此扩展名(例如,对于Chrome,ffox)将无关紧要。


您将不得不拦截对url处理程序的调用,或者在您喜欢的浏览器上安装扩展程序,以使您在打开新标签页时单击“是”或“否”。无论哪种方式,它都会很快变得非常烦人。
jnovack

2
您在说什么操作系统?
slhck

确实存在的任何软件都不会非常有效。有十二种方法可以打开无法被另一个应用程序阻止的进程。
Ramhound

或者-如何编写一个最小的应用程序,该应用程序将在Windows,KDE和Gnome 的默认浏览器选项列表中“呈现” ?任何二进制文件或可执行文件都可以充当该角色,还是必须向某些OS API注册?
ЯрославРахматуллин

@jnovack的想法是您不希望浏览器打开(假设它尚未运行),因此扩展名将无关紧要。
专利

Answers:


3

您可以尝试浏览器选择器。它是一个充当默认浏览器的程序,但实际上,您可以选择打开哪个URL的浏览器。如果您不想打开URL,请关闭“浏览器选择器”窗口。


-1

或者,如果您使用的是chrome,则可以使用AdBlock。它关闭所有不必要的窗口。


我不会拒绝您的回答,但是原始帖子(以及现在对OP的修改)下的注释阐明了浏览器扩展是无用的,其想法是在呼叫到达正常浏览器之前对其进行拦截,以使您不会甚至不需要打开浏览器(如果未运行)。
专利
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.